ABU DHABI // Abu Dhabi TV has launched what it hopes will become a leading sports broadcaster in the region.
The unveiling of Yas at the President’s Endurance Cup – which was the first event the channel covered – affirmed 2015 as a year of development and excellence, said Sheikh Hazza bin Zayed, the National Security Adviser.
He said there was a need for a channel that focused on traditional sports.
Besides covering local and international sports events, Yas will also broadcast documentaries, contests and news.
Its daily shows include Flash News and Lifestyle, which is focused on health, nutrition and fitness.
Morning shows such as Marhaban Al Alam will host celebrities and guests to discuss traditional sports.
Al Hatheera, a weekly show, will look at the sport of falconry, while Al Rakkad will showcase Arabian sports of Emirati and Gulf origins.
Al Fares will centre on horse racing, while Al Qudra will cover endurance racing. Water and marine sports will be featured on the weekly Al Serdal.
"Yas cultivates sports by showcasing them on a global platform for today's audiences," said Mohamed Ebraheem Al Mahmood, chairman and managing director of Abu Dhabi Media, publishers of The National.
